Green’s Dictionary of Slang

special adj.

1. especially interested or informed.

[UK]J. Galt Lawrie Todd I Pt II 120: I ain’t special ’bout pedigrees; but my wife [...] wont have nobody call me but squire.
[US]S. Bechet Treat It Gentle 151: [H]e said, ‘Sidney, come on inside. My friend wants to see you.’ Well I knew better than that [...] So I said, ‘You tell your friend I’m not special about seeing him.’.

2. (US campus) unpleasant.

[US]Eble Campus Sl. Mar.

3. (US teen) odd and slightly interesting.

[US]A. Swartz ‘Sweet, Tight and Hella Stupid’ in S.F. University High School Update Mar.–Apr. 2: special – odd, interesting (but not very).
